Clojure If Statement

(ns clojure.examples.hello
   (:gen-class))

;; This program displays Hello World
(defn Example [] (
   if ( = 2 2)
   (println "Values are equal")
   (println "Values are not equal")))
(Example)

Clojure Loop Statement

(ns clojure.examples.hello
   (:gen-class))

;; This program displays Hello World
(defn Example []
   (loop [x 10]
      (when (> x 1)
         (println x)
         (recur (- x 2))))) 
(Example)

Clojure While Statement

(ns clojure.examples.hello
   (:gen-class))

;; This program displays Hello World
(defn Example []
   (def x (atom 1))
   (while ( < @x 5 )
      (do
         (println @x)
         (swap! x inc))))
(Example)

Clojure Arithmetic Operators

(ns clojure.examples.hello
   (:gen-class))

;; This program displays Hello World
(defn Example []
   (def x (+ 2 2))
   (println x)
   
   (def x (- 2 1))
   (println x)
   
   (def x (* 2 2))
   (println x)
   
   (def x (float(/ 2 1)))
   (println x)
   
   (def x (inc 2))
   (println x)
   
   (def x (dec 2))
   (println x)
   
   (def x (max 1 2 3))
   (println x)
   
   (def x (min 1 2 3))
   (println x)
   
   (def x (rem 3 2))
   (println x))
(Example)

Clojure Variables

(ns clojure.examples.hello
   (:gen-class))

;; This program displays Hello World
(defn Example []
   ;; The below code declares a integer variable
   (def x 1)
   
   ;; The below code declares a float variable
   (def y 1.25)
   
   ;; The below code declares a string variable
   (def str1 "Hello")
   (println x)
   (println y)
   (println str1))
(Example)
